 All the support is for the Argentine here and I'll add to that. Del Potro hasn't dropped a set for quite a few matches and is in the best form of his short career. His serve is massively improved and his groundstrokes are becoming more difficult and powerful. He hits big off both sides now due to the extra concentration on his backhand. Delic has performed very well in front of the American fans and came through a deciding set tie-breaker with Moya yesterday. He is also serving well giving few opportunities away cheaply. Del Potro has the quality, confidence and power to see this out in my opinion and everything considered, I'm predicting a 2-0 victory.

 Juan Martin won his first career ATP tour title at the Mercedes Cup in Stuttgart, beating Richard Gasquet in straight sets in the final. Del Potro reached his second career ATP Tour final only one week later at the Austrian Open in Kitzbühel, where he beat local hope and sixth seed Jurgen Melzer 6–2, 6–1, in less than an hour, to claim his second title in two weeks. Really, the kid is in brilliant form and besides Fernando Gonzalez (until now), i see him as one of the very few future threats to Rafael Nadal on clay. Not much to add to it, Delic was able to defeat Moya as i said and placed a bet, but he is no match for the young argentine

Tip: The difference in Match Rating between two players represents the average number of service games that separate them in a set of tennis as predicted by the Insight Model. Lower Rating Handle values indicate that the predicted rating is more speculative and that the player’s ‘true’ form may be significantly different from the models statistical prediction.
